Common Asphalt Lot Paving Jobs
Parking Lot Paving - provides durable surfaces for residential driveways and commercial parking areas.
Driveway Resurfacing - restores the smoothness and appearance of existing asphalt driveways.
New Asphalt Installations - creates long-lasting paved surfaces for homes and businesses.
Crack Filling and Sealing - helps prevent water damage and extends the lifespan of asphalt surfaces.
Patchwork and Repairs - addresses potholes and damaged areas to maintain safety and functionality.
Asphalt Striping - adds clear markings for parking spaces and traffic flow.
Asphalt Lot Paving Questions
What types of projects are suitable for asphalt lot paving? Asphalt paving is ideal for driveways, parking lots, and small to large commercial areas needing durable surfaces.
How long does asphalt paving typically last? With proper maintenance, asphalt surfaces generally last 15 to 20 years.
What are common reasons to choose asphalt paving? Asphalt provides a smooth, cost-effective, and quick-installation option for various property types.
What should property owners consider before paving? Ensuring proper site preparation and drainage helps achieve a long-lasting asphalt surface.
